CVE-2025-12073
Last modified
CVE-2025-12073 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 4.3/10 on the CVSS scale. GitLab has remediated an issue in GitLab CE/EE affecting all versions from 18.0 before 18.6.6, 18.7 before 18.7.4, and 18.8 before 18.8.4 that, under certain conditions, could have allowed an authenticated user to perform server-side request forgery against internal services by bypassing protections in the Git repository import functionality.. EPSS estimates a 0.23%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
